REV Collective is an innovative new cafe and drive-thru concept opening soon in Meridian, Idaho. This independent and owner-operated establishment emphasizes a health-conscious kitchen philosophy, focusing on breakfast and simple lunch items made with real ingredients, all cooked from scratch. The cafe is committed to sourcing locally whenever possible, avoiding seed oils, and using real fats to create food that not only tastes delicious but also contributes positively to customers' well-being. As a fresh addition to the Meridian dining scene, REV Collective combines wholesome food with a strong dedication to quality and community values, creating a unique experience for its guests. The concept steers clear of corporate templates, choosing instead to prioritize authenticity, creativity, and a hands-on approach to delivering exceptional food and service.
The role of Lead Cook & Chef at REV Collective is a foundational position destined for someone who desires more than merely following an existing menu. This full-time position located at 1630 S. Eagle Rd in Meridian offers a competitive salary dependent on experience. The successful candidate will be instrumental in developing and finalizing the menu alongside ownership before the grand opening. Their responsibilities will span building recipes, setting quality and prep standards, and leading the kitchen team in daily operations within a brand new, state-of-the-art kitchen environment. This is an exciting opportunity for an aspiring chef who wants to influence the culinary direction and make a significant impact in the Treasure Valley community.
The ideal candidate will have at least three years of professional kitchen experience – preferably in roles such as lead cook, sous chef, or kitchen manager – and will have a strong background in scratch cooking at volume, with the ability to maintain speed, consistency, and cleanliness even during busy service periods. They will share REV Collective’s commitment to ingredient transparency and health-focused cooking, want to collaborate in sourcing ingredients locally, and bring a builder’s mindset to create systems and standards from the ground up. Leadership skills are essential, as the lead cook will be responsible for training, coaching, and managing the kitchen team, ensuring a clean, well-organized, and compliant kitchen environment.
This position offers more than just a job; it presents a chance to be a founding member of a new concept, shaping the menu and the kitchen culture from conception through ongoing operations. The candidate will work closely with the owner in a fully equipped kitchen featuring top-tier appliances like griddles, ranges, and combi ovens. Early morning, weekend, and pre-opening hours are expected as part of this immersive opportunity.
Joining REV Collective means being part of a team that values real creative input and genuine collaboration. The company fosters an environment where ideas are appreciated and ownership is encouraged, building towards an operation anchored in quality, values, and culinary excellence. For an up-and-coming chef eager to carve out a name and reputation within the Treasure Valley’s vibrant food scene, this role offers a unique pathway to professional growth and achievement.
